ESF #5 – Emergency Management<br />

State Revise the current State EOP to better<br />

address management <strong>of</strong> catastrophic<br />

events. The revised EOP should improve<br />

knowledge <strong>of</strong> the ESFs <strong>and</strong> <strong>of</strong> EOC<br />

operations; improve knowledge <strong>of</strong> State<br />

agency roles <strong>and</strong> responsibilities in the<br />

EOC because they are not assigned by the<br />

ESFs; ensure consistency <strong>of</strong> SOPs with<br />

ESFs <strong>and</strong> the NRP; improve State,<br />

regional, <strong>and</strong> parish knowledge <strong>of</strong> ICS <strong>and</strong><br />

NIMS; improve the State’s ability to<br />

sustain operations during a catastrophic<br />

event, <strong>and</strong> assign roles <strong>and</strong> responsibilities<br />

for State agencies.<br />

Ensure adequate staffing is available, <strong>and</strong><br />

plan for the transition from predisaster to<br />

a disaster situation.<br />

Prepare to execute predisaster contracts for<br />

the acquisition <strong>of</strong> resources.<br />

Establish an incident management team<br />

with mobile Comm<strong>and</strong> Post.<br />

Create a State EOC that has the capability<br />

to manage operations during a<br />

catastrophic event.<br />

Address the Stafford Act’s lack <strong>of</strong><br />

applicability by creating provisions to<br />

include faith-based, nonpr<strong>of</strong>it, <strong>and</strong> forpr<strong>of</strong>it<br />

entities <strong>and</strong> to reimburse for 8-hour<br />

work day.<br />

Hold annual refresher training on plans.<br />

Exercise plans annually.<br />

Hold State, regional, <strong>and</strong> parish training <strong>and</strong><br />

exercising on NIMS/ICS.<br />

Develop COOP plans for each ESF.<br />

Establish regional coordinators.<br />
